National Sustainable Development Strategy
A mechanism: integrate principles of sustainable development into national policies and strategies
Build on: existing social, economic and environmental policies
Process involves: situation analysis, formulation of policies and action plans, implementation, monitoring and regular review
Institutionalized the process: consultation, negotiation, mediation, and consensus building

National Council for Sustainable Development
Role: A multistakeholder’s forum: representatives from government,
business and civil society Facilitate preparation and implementation of NSDS Enabling broad partnership and facilitate the focused participation Play key role in promoting awareness and information dissemination
on sustainable development
2.9NCSD
Structure: Comprise of Chair, Council/Board, Committee and Subcommittees
and Secretariat Chair: A head of government to influence policy and decision
making Council: Government and Non-government representatives (40:60) Government representatives: Planning, finance and environment
ministries
